DIRECTIONS

Image Step 01
01 Step

Recipe View 5 mins Preheat oven to 450 degrees F (230 degrees C). (5 minutes)

Image Step 02
02 Step

Recipe View 5 mins In a large bowl, whisk together pumpkin puree, evaporated milk, eggs, granulated sugar, all-purpose flour, salt, vanilla extract, and ground cinnamon until smooth. (5 minutes)

Image Step 03
03 Step

Recipe View 2 mins Pour the pumpkin mixture into the unbaked pie crust, spreading evenly. (2 minutes)

Image Step 04
04 Step

Recipe View 15 mins Bake in the preheated oven for 15 minutes to set the crust and begin cooking the filling. (15 minutes)

Image Step 05
05 Step

Recipe View 45 mins Reduce the oven tem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) and continue baking for 40-45 minutes, or until a knife inserted into the center comes out clean. (40-45 minutes)

Image Step 06
06 Step

Recipe View 2 hrs Let the pie cool completely on a wire rack before serving. This allows the filling to fully set. (2 hours)

For an extra layer of flavor, try adding a pinch of nutmeg or ginger along with the cinnamon.
If the pie crust edges are browning too quickly, cover them with foil or a pie shield during the last 20 minutes of baking.
Cooling the pie completely is crucial for the filling to set properly, so be patient!
Store leftover pie in the refrigerator.
